The evolution from Alt+Tab to the modern (introduced with Windows 10) marks a significant philosophical development in operating system design. While Alt+Tab is a linear, modal list—a simple queue of icons—the Win+Tab shortcut embraced the age of visual computing. It launches "Task View," a full-screen, tile-based interface that shows live thumbnails of all open windows and virtual desktops. This transition from a textual list to a spatial, visual grid reflects a deeper understanding of human memory. Users do not remember that "Document4.docx" is the third item in a list; they remember its shape , its content , and its location on the screen. By presenting a visual snapshot, the shortcut reduces the cognitive load from logical recall to pattern recognition, making the act of switching screens instantaneous and almost subconscious.
